We spent the morning with Chef Paolo, and had a wonderful time (some bad jokes included), and learned quite a bit. Italian cooking is all about making the most of fresh ingredients; over the course of 3+ hours, and under his guidance we helped him prepare 10 separate dishes (3 antipasti, 3 primi, 3 secondi + panna Cotta), taking time after each round to gorge ourselves on truly fresh, tasty and contrasting selections. Ours was the fish and seafood section, so we enjoyed multiple versions of fresh branzino, clams, mussels, shrimp & calamari, with crispy fresh veggies and a crisp little chardonnay from the Veneto. A whole lot of fun, but plan to spend the rest of the day feeling incredibly happy and full. We will do it again when we return to the wonderful town of Lucca
